Once you accept weight weenidom, you are lost. Along those lines I have had tremendous good experience with lightly used Zero Gravity Ti brake calipers. They are only 195g and are always available on ebay. I have never paid more than about $165 for them and have always been completely satisfied. Work great, good condition used, pads are in good shape, and so on. Now that would be a weight savings! If you should go that route, be sure what you buy is post-2005 when some significant design improvements were made.
